The Ural-5323 ( Russian Урал-5323 , also called URAL-5323 by the manufacturer ) is a heavy truck with four axles and all-wheel drive , which is also used for military purposes. The vehicle is produced by the Russian Uralsky Avtomobilny Sawod , or UralAZ for short, in Miass .

Vehicle history

The idea of ​​a heavy, all-terrain, four-axle vehicle already existed in Soviet times. As early as 1964, the NAMI-058 was built in the vehicle construction institute NAMI , which is similar in structure to the Ural-5323, but uses different technology. It was only after the collapse of the Soviet Union, however, that the Ural-5323 was first mass-produced in 1991, at that time with cabs from KamAZ and engines from in-house production of the UralAZ.

Three years later, in 1994, Iveco and the Uralsky Avtomobilny Sawod founded a cooperation. This made it possible to replace the unsuitable KamAZ cabs with cabs from the Iveco T range . Up to 2000 there were only short cabs, after that versions with sleeping places could also be ordered.

The engines used during the construction period changed more frequently. Both KamAZ diesel engines and the UralAZ itself were used. Later the Jaroslawski Motorny Sawod delivered different versions of the JaMZ-238 , but six-cylinder JaMZ-236 were also used. As of 2016, six-cylinder in-line diesel engines of the more modern type JaMZ-536 will also be used.

Model variants

In the course of the production, which has now lasted two and a half decades, various variants of the Ural-5323 were manufactured in the UralAZ. In particular, the chassis is also used for special bodies. The following list is not complete and shows the status from 2010.

  • Ural-5323 and Ural-532301 - basic models with a flatbed structure.
  • Ural-532361 - Chassis with driver's cab for individual superstructures, 15 tons payload.
  • Ural-542301 - tractor unit based on the Ural-5323 for trailers with a total weight of up to 28 tons, fully off-road.
  • Ural-6902 - As a timber transporter designed vehicle for 13.5 tons payload, can be used in combination with the appropriate trailer of type 89721-10.
  • US6 / 30-532361 - Special vehicle with a body for the oil industry, which makes it possible to mix cement or chemicals with water on site and fill them into boreholes.
  • UTsN-4-5323 - Pump vehicle, with the help of which liquids can be injected into earth boreholes.
  • AKN-14 - tank truck with 14,000 l capacity for fuels of all kinds.

Technical specifications

For the basic model with a flatbed in a civil version (Ural-532301).

  • Engine: V8 diesel engine with turbocharging, water-cooled
  • Engine type: JaMZ-238B
  • Power: 220 PS (162 kW)
  • Torque 1180 Nm at 1200 to 1400 min -1
  • Displacement: 14.86 l
  • Gearbox: eight-speed gearbox with double reduction for off-road use
  • Consumption at a constant 60 km / h: 40 l / 100 km
  • Tank capacity: 300 + 210 l
  • Top speed: 85 km / h
  • Seats: 2 at the front, optionally 36 on the loading area
  • Drive formula : 8 × 8

Dimensions and weights

  • Length: 8600 mm
  • Width: 2500 mm
  • Height: 3191 mm
  • Ground clearance: 400 mm
  • Turning circle: 28 m diameter
  • Gradeability: 58%
  • maximum negotiable gradient: 20%
  • Fording depth: 1200 mm
  • Trench width that can be traversed: 1200 mm
  • Tire size: 14.00-20, individually all around, with tire pressure control system
  • Payload: 10,000 kg
  • permissible total weight: 21,900 kg
  • permissible trailer load: 12,000 kg
  • Front axle load (double axle): 9995 kg
  • Rear axle load (double axle): 11,905 kg
